Our platform is designed to help both experienced and aspiring prep school teachers find the best job opportunities in the sector without the hassle of repetitive applications.
Once you register, you'll be added to our database, which matches candidates with leading jobs in the prep school sector. The process is streamlined to ensure a quick and easy registration.
No, you only need to complete our one-time online application. This is compliant with KCSIE standards and can be used for all future applications, saving you time and effort.

The traffic light system is a unique feature that allows you to indicate your current job-seeking status:

  • RED means you're content in your current position.
  • AMBER indicates you're open to specific roles or schools.
  • GREEN shows you're actively seeking a new challenge.
Once a job role matches your preferences, we will notify you even before it's advertised to the public. This gives you an advantage and exclusive access to prime opportunities.
Yes, if you're shortlisted for a position, you can pick a convenient interview slot. This includes weekdays, evenings, or even weekends.
We believe in continuous growth. If you're not selected, we'll provide constructive feedback based on the school's response to help you prepare better for future opportunities.
